In the heart of Detroit's Cass Corridor, 8 Degrees Plato has been more than just a beer store; it’s been a cultural hub, a community gathering space, and a symbol of the city’s craft beer renaissance. For nearly a decade, this cherished bottle shop and bar has delighted beer enthusiasts with its meticulously curated selection of craft brews, hard ciders, meads, and wines. For those living in Metro Detroit, it became a staple for discovering unique beverages and connecting with fellow enthusiasts. However, as the year draws to a close, so too will the story of 8 Degrees Plato. For decades, Marvin’s Marvelous Mechanical Museum has stood as a cultural and nostalgic landmark in Metro Detroit, delighting visitors with its unique blend of vintage arcade games, eccentric memorabilia, and mechanical curiosities. From its early days at Tally Hall in the 1980s to its long-running stint at Hunter’s Square in Farmington Hills, Marvin’s has been a place where fun, nostalgia, and community converge.

Now, this beloved institution is preparing to write the next chapter in its storied history. Facing the prospect of relocation due to redevelopment plans at its current site, Marvin’s is embarking on an exciting move to Orchard Mall in West Bloomfield Township.
